Suryakumar Yadav Reacts to Removal as India’s T20I Captain After 2026 World Cup Win

Analysed 29 Aug 2026·4 sources analysed·India·Sports
Suryakumar Yadav Reacts to Removal as India’s T20I Captain After 2026 World Cup WinPreviousNext

Suryakumar Yadav, who captained India to the 2026 T20 World Cup victory, was unexpectedly dropped from the T20I squad and relieved of his captaincy shortly after the tournament. Despite India's unbeaten series record under his leadership, selectors appointed Shreyas Iyer as the new captain. Suryakumar expressed initial shock but accepted the decision, acknowledging the selectors' intent to build for the future amid his recent inconsistent batting form. He remains grateful for his opportunities and respects the selectors' choice.
